Step into the world of Julio Romero de Torres with his captivating portrait, Ysolina Gállego de Zubiaurre. This stunning 1910 painting, a masterpiece of Spanish art, is currently on display at the prestigious Museo Nacional Centro de Arte Reina Sofía. Standing at 1.67 meters tall and 0.95 meters wide, the artwork immediately commands attention. nn The painting centers on Ysolina Gállego de Zubiaurre, a young woman elegantly poised, seemingly framed within a doorway or alcove. She is dressed in a flowing, light beige gown adorned with exquisite lace detailing at the sleeves, neckline, and hem. A white sash cinches her waist, accentuating the classic Empire-waist silhouette. Her dark hair is neatly styled, and a delicate necklace adds a touch of refinement. Her expression is serene and composed, holding a light-colored object, perhaps a handkerchief or small bag, in her right hand. nn Romero de Torres masterfully employs a soft, diffused light, avoiding harsh shadows and creating a warm, inviting atmosphere. The muted color palette, dominated by the beige of the gown and the earthy tones of the background landscape, enhances the overall sense of quiet elegance. The background itself is a tranquil scene of dark green trees, lighter green hills, and a calm body of water, providing a subtle yet effective contrast to the figure of Ysolina. nn This portrait exemplifies Romero de Torres's distinctive style, a blend of realism and romanticism. His meticulous attention to detail in depicting the texture of the lace and the subtle nuances of Ysolina's expression showcases his technical skill. The painting offers a glimpse into the fashion and social customs of early 20th-century Spain, making it a significant piece within its historical and cultural context.
